Transaction 24ef56147f1d8f8e933963ad236eb64288bb5d83134af4b2eddf95af50cb6d51

1 Input
2 Outputs
  • 24ef56147f1d8f8e933963ad236eb64288bb5d83134af4b2eddf95af50cb6d51:0
  • value  13936806
    address  19HkKnDPhvLwULhkximYABubSQiAvsSgJy
  • 24ef56147f1d8f8e933963ad236eb64288bb5d83134af4b2eddf95af50cb6d51:1
  • value  11647000
    address  1PcGeWueKzHAs464XdxerfFypUFLiSWLEQ